Matching Size to Job



Efficiently matching the dumpster dimension to your job is vital for efficient waste management. To figure out the right size, think about the extent and nature of your project.

For little household cleanouts or improvements, a 10-yard dumpster might be adequate. These are generally 12 feet long and can hold about 4 pickup truck loads of waste.

For larger projects like redesigning multiple rooms or removing a large estate, a 20-yard dumpster might be better. These are around 22 feet long and can hold roughly 8 pickup lots.

If you're taking on a significant building and construction task or industrial restoration, a 30-yard dumpster could be the best fit. These dumpsters have to do with 22 feet long and can fit concerning 12 pickup truck tons of particles.



Matching the dumpster dimension to your project ensures you have adequate space for all waste materials without overpaying for unused capability.
